| Metric | 8x8 | Amazon Webstore | Winner |
|---|---|---|---|
| Performance | 35 | 31 | 8x8 |
| Accessibility | 56 | 89 | Amazon Webstore |
| Best Practices | 77 | 78 | Amazon Webstore |
| SEO | 92 | 91 | 8x8 |
| Security | 79 | 64 | 8x8 |
| TTFB | 866ms | 321ms | Amazon Webstore |
| Composite | 79 | 71 | 8x8 |
8x8 outperforms Amazon Webstore in 4 of 7 categories, with a stronger composite score (79 vs 71). Amazon Webstore leads in accessibility, best practices, TTFB.
Choose 8x8 when your primary concern is security and performance. Its audit data shows consistent strength in these areas across the sampled sites.
Choose Amazon Webstore when your primary concern is server response time and accessibility. Its audit data shows consistent strength in these areas across the sampled sites.
Scores are medians across 1 audited 8x8 sites and 44 audited Amazon Webstore sites in the BeaverCheck database. Every audit runs the same 100+ checks — Lighthouse performance, security headers, accessibility, SEO, server response time — against a real URL. No vendor input, no sponsorship, no affiliate links. Small sample: one or both technologies have fewer than 10 audited sites. Treat these numbers as directional — medians stabilize around 20–30 audits per side.
